Gravitation

This chapter covers the universal law of gravitation, acceleration due to gravity, gravitational potential energy, and motion of satellites.

The universal law of gravitation

2m2/10
πŸ“Œ Key FormulaF = G m₁mβ‚‚/rΒ²
2

Acceleration due to gravity and its variation with altitude and depth

2m3/10
πŸ“Œ Key Formulag' = g(1 - 2h/R) for h << R, g' = g(1 - d/R) for depth d
3

Kepler’s law of planetary motion

2m2/10
πŸ“Œ Key FormulaLaw of orbits (ellipses), law of areas (equal area in equal time), law of periods (TΒ² ∝ rΒ³)
4

Gravitational potential energy

2m2/10
πŸ“Œ Key FormulaU = -GMm/r
5

Escape velocity

2m2/10
πŸ“Œ Key Formulav_esc = √(2GM/R) = √(2gR)
6

Orbital velocity of a satellite

2m2/10
πŸ“Œ Key Formulavβ‚€ = √(GM/r)
7

Geo stationary satellites

2m2/10
πŸ“Œ Key FormulaOrbital period = 24 hours, in equatorial plane, altitude ~ 36000 km.
